Taylorville Public Library Summer Reading Program

With the registration for Taylorville Public Library Summer Reading Program officially past the library is excited to start the program.

 

Sarah Zogotta is an Assistant Librarian it Taylorville Public Library. She says the program has been going on for over 20 years but the goal remains the same of keeping kids reading.

 

 

Zagotta says the program is all about reaching the daily reading goal, which varies from child to child.

 

 

Zagotta says there are plenty of great prizes for children that take the program seriously and accomplish their reading goals.

 

 

The Taylorville Public Library still has programs available for children not in the Summer Reading Program, including Story Time on the first and third Tuesday of the month at 10:30.
